The **Watlow 88-30500-500 ANAFAZE CL-S204 4-Loop Controller Panel-Mount** is a high-performance, industrial-grade temperature control solution designed to deliver precise and reliable regulation for demanding applications across manufacturing, process automation, and HVAC systems. Engineered with Watlow s reputation for durability and engineering excellence, this compact yet robust controller panel-mount unit integrates seamlessly into existing control systems, offering unmatched flexibility for multi-loop temperature management. Featuring a **4-loop architecture**, it excels in managing complex thermal processes where multiple zones or independent heating/cooling circuits require synchronized control such as in furnaces, ovens, drying systems, or industrial heat exchangers. The **ANAFAZE CL-S204** platform leverages advanced digital signal processing and high-resolution analog-to-digital conversion to ensure sub-degree accuracy, minimizing overshoot and drift while maintaining stability under fluctuating load conditions. Its **panel-mount design** allows for easy integration into control panels, electrical enclosures, or custom-built systems, with a sleek, space-efficient footprint that maximizes cabinet utilization without compromising functionality.

Built to withstand the rigors of industrial environments, this controller is constructed with **high-quality materials and robust electronics**, featuring **wide input voltage compatibility** (typically 120VAC, 240VAC, or 230VAC, depending on configuration) and **isolated outputs** for enhanced safety and noise immunity. The **4 independent control loops** can be configured as PID, ON/OFF, or proportional-only controllers, allowing operators to tailor each channel to specific process requirements whether for resistive heating, fluid temperature regulation, or phase change applications. The unit supports **modbus RTU communication**, enabling seamless integration with SCADA systems, PLCs, or other industrial networks for remote monitoring, logging, and troubleshooting, while its **user-friendly front-panel interface** provides real-time feedback on setpoints, process variables, and alarm conditions. Additionally, the controller s **relay or solid-state output options** (depending on model variant) offer versatility in driving actuators, contactors, or power supplies, ensuring compatibility with a wide range of heating elements, pumps, or cooling systems.

Watlow s **ANAFAZE CL-S204** series is particularly well-suited for applications requiring **high repeatability and energy efficiency**, such as **metal heat treatment, plastic extrusion, food processing, or pharmaceutical manufacturing**, where precise temperature control is critical to product quality and process consistency. The controller s **auto-tuning capability** simplifies setup by dynamically optimizing PID parameters, reducing the need for manual calibration and minimizing downtime during commissioning. Furthermore, its **expandable architecture** allows for future upgrades or additional loop configurations, making it a scalable solution for evolving industrial needs. With **IP65-rated enclosures** (when panel-mounted) and **wide operating temperature ranges**, this controller is built to endure harsh conditions while maintaining peak performance, ensuring long-term reliability in even the most demanding environments. Whether deployed in a cleanroom, a high-vibration manufacturing floor, or a corrosive chemical processing plant, the **Watlow 88-30500-500 ANAFAZE CL-S204** delivers the precision, durability, and adaptability required to meet the most exacting industrial temperature control challenges.

The **Watlow 88-30500-500 ANAFAZE CLS204 4-loop controller** is a high-performance industrial temperature controller designed for precise control of multiple heating or cooling loops in applications such as industrial furnaces, ovens, or process heating systems. Below is a detailed breakdown of its pros and cons, followed by a conclusion and recommendation.

---

### **Pros**

1. **High Precision and Reliability**

The CLS204 is known for its advanced PID control algorithms, which provide accurate temperature regulation with minimal overshoot or drift. This is critical in applications where consistency is essential, such as annealing, curing, or material processing.

2. **Modular and Scalable Design**

As a 4-loop controller, it can manage up to four independent temperature zones, making it versatile for systems requiring simultaneous control of multiple heaters or sensors. Additional loops can often be added via expansion modules or software upgrades, depending on the system configuration.

3. **Analog and Digital Flexibility**

The controller supports a wide range of input/output options, including analog signals (4-20 mA, 0-10 V), digital relays, and communication protocols like Modbus RTU. This compatibility ensures it can integrate with various sensors, actuators, and industrial networks without requiring extensive modifications.

4. **Durable and Industrial-Grade Build**

Watlow controllers are built to withstand harsh environments, including temperature fluctuations, vibration, and electrical noise. The panel-mount design also makes it suitable for installation in enclosed control panels or directly on machinery.

5. **User-Friendly Interface**

The CLS204 features a clear LCD display with intuitive navigation, allowing operators to monitor and adjust parameters easily. Some models include touchscreen interfaces or remote monitoring capabilities via software (e.g., Watlow s **ANAFAZE Studio**).

6. **Energy Efficiency**

Advanced control algorithms optimize power usage by minimizing unnecessary heating cycles, which can reduce operational costs over time. This is particularly beneficial in large-scale industrial applications.

7. **Compatibility with Watlow Heaters**

If your system uses Watlow heaters (e.g., cartridge, band, or strip heaters), this controller is designed to work seamlessly with them, ensuring optimal performance and safety features like over-temperature protection.

8. **Remote Monitoring and Diagnostics**

Many ANAFAZE controllers support remote connectivity, allowing technicians to troubleshoot issues or adjust settings from a distance. This reduces downtime and improves maintenance efficiency.

9. **Long-Term Support and Warranty**

Watlow is a well-established brand with robust customer support, including technical documentation, training, and warranty coverage. This can be reassuring for long-term reliability.

10. **Future-Proofing**

The controller supports firmware updates and may be compatible with emerging industrial IoT (IIoT) standards, extending its usability as technology evolves.

---

### **Cons**

1. **High Initial Cost**

The CLS204 is a premium industrial controller, and its price reflects its advanced features. For small-scale or low-budget applications, this may be prohibitive compared to simpler or cheaper alternatives (e.g., basic PID controllers or PLC-based solutions).

2. **Complexity for Non-Experts**

While the interface is user-friendly, configuring advanced parameters (e.g., PID tuning, loop interactions) may require technical expertise. Misconfiguration could lead to poor performance or equipment damage.

3. **Limited Built-In Safety Features (Compared to PLCs)**

While the CLS204 includes safety features like over-temperature alarms, it lacks the comprehensive safety protocols (e.g., fail-safe interlocks, emergency stop integration) found in dedicated safety PLCs. For highly hazardous applications, additional safeguards may be needed.

4. **Dependence on Watlow Ecosystem**

If your system relies heavily on Watlow components (heaters, sensors), switching to a different brand s controller may require recalibration or compatibility testing. This can limit flexibility if you later need to diversify suppliers.

5. **Software Learning Curve**

Advanced features like **ANAFAZE Studio** or Modbus communication require familiarity with industrial software. Training may be necessary for operators or engineers to fully utilize these capabilities.

6. **Physical Space Requirements**

As a panel-mount unit, it occupies more space than compact or DIN-rail-mounted controllers. This may be a constraint in tight control panel designs.

7. **Potential for Overkill in Simple Applications**

If your system only requires basic temperature control (e.g., a single-loop oven), the CLS204 s advanced features may be unnecessary, making a simpler controller (e.g., a 1- or 2-loop model) a more cost-effective choice.

8. **Firmware and Compatibility Risks**

While Watlow provides updates, occasional firmware changes could introduce compatibility issues with existing sensors or actuators. Always verify compatibility before purchasing.

9. **No Built-In Data Logging (Standard)**

While some models offer logging via software, the controller itself does not store historical data. For applications requiring detailed records (e.g., compliance or process optimization), additional logging hardware may be needed.

10. **Limited Customization for Non-Standard Applications**

The CLS204 is optimized for typical industrial heating/cooling tasks. For highly specialized applications (e.g., cryogenic systems, vacuum furnaces), third-party modifications or additional controllers may be required.

---

### **Conclusion**

The **Watlow 88-30500-500 ANAFAZE CLS204** is a robust, high-performance controller ideal for applications demanding precise, multi-loop temperature control in industrial environments. Its strengths lie in its reliability, flexibility, and integration with Watlow s ecosystem, making it a strong choice for manufacturers, research labs, or process industries where consistency and efficiency are critical.

However, its high cost, complexity, and potential overkill for simpler applications mean it may not be the best fit for budget-conscious or low-complexity setups. Additionally, users without technical expertise may struggle with advanced configurations.

For most **industrial heating, annealing, or curing processes** especially those requiring **multiple independent loops, energy efficiency, or remote monitoring** the CLS204 is a justified investment. For **small-scale, low-budget, or non-industrial applications**, a simpler controller or PLC-based solution might be more appropriate.
